Movantik for Constipation, Drug Induced User Reviews (Page 3)

Movantik has an average rating of 4.7 out of 10 from a total of 146 reviews for the treatment of Constipation, Drug Induced. 34% of reviewers reported a positive experience, while 51% reported a negative experience.
